Now for some of the Greek clubs that are building new arenas, which are much needed.

Panionios B.C. is going to have a new arena that the club will own and it will be built as a part of their new sports complex. It will be placed at one corner of their football pitch and will have open inside doors access to the track, weight room, and the pool.

This should be a huge development for Panionios because although they have a decent fan base, they have really had an out of date arena and if they wanted to play in a European competition they had to rent another arena.

Hopefully, their new arena will help them out a lot.

This is the old Panionios arena, Nea Smyrni Indoor Hall (which they currently use), which the club has been using on and off for years. Although they have done quite a bit of work on it recently to improve it, clearly it is very outdated.

(Capacity: 2,000)

Kolossos Rhodes B.C. is also building a new arena.

This is their current arena, Venetoklio Indoor Hall, which although nice, is way too small.

(Capacity: 1,300)

[Image: 1272357891.jpg?t=1292613989]

[Image: venetokleio.jpg?t=1292871989]

The club can't currently play in European competitions because the capacity of the current arena does not meet the minimum seating capacity requirements of ULEB regulations. That is why the club had to forfeit their place in the Eurocup competition this season. So they are building a new arena which will allow them to play in European competitions.

These are pics of the work on the new Kolossos Rhodes B.C. Indoor Arena:

(Capacity: 3,500) - the design will allow for more tiers of seats to be added if they need to have 5,000 in order to play Euroleague/Eurocup down the road.

Iraklis Thessaloniki B.C. is also building a new multi-sports complex.

This is the current arena of Iraklis, Ivanofio Indoor Hall, which is obviously too outdated and too small and needs to be replaced. It is too small to play in European competitions, so the club needs a newer and bigger arena.

(Capacity: 2,500)
